ouch my eyes

 

Jun 26, 2011 by MrWright

After owning the EVO4g I decide to go out and get this phone..........and its pretty much what I expected

PROS
very fast
Amazing picture
Nice size
Takes great pics(2D)
Good battery life (considering the EVO4g sucked)

CONS
3D PICTURE, Now its not really a con as much as its a disappointment. I mean you really have to look at it from an angle to see it, and don't stare to long or you might hurt your eyes.

CONCLUSION
I wish they would of just named this phone the EVO4GX, because it does everything the 4G did but just better. By calling it the 3d I would expect way better 3d pics, but overall great phone

Nice upgrade, but not that much better than the Evo 4g!

 

Jul 1, 2011 by dbram84

The Evo 3d is a good phone, but I'm not totally blown away. I've done web browsing speed test between the EVO 3d and EVO 4g and I must say the EVO 4g is not that far behind. Some pages loaded quicker on the EVO 4g, but for the most part the EVO 3d loaded pages faster only around five seconds quicker than the EVO 4g. The new HTC sense 3.0 is fantastic and is really convenient for the user. The 3d looks great once you find your sweet spot so images looks like its popping off the screen. 3d video playback looks great also. The speakerphone is alright I personally prefer the EVO 4g speakerphone its clearer and much louder. Pictures came out decent slighty more detailed than the EVO 4g. I was really impressed not only with video recording, but the audio while video recording its nice and clear HTC did a great job at that. Video recording at 720p looks amazing and shows pretty good detail. Battery life is exceptional i can get a full days use out of it unlike the EVO 4G. The qhd screen is much improved over the EVO 4g its super sharp and colors look good its on par with the iphone display. The dual core processors allows this phone to be fast and lag free which is needed now days with users running multiple applications. The phone also feels really good in your hands I love the built quality. Overall if your not a fan of 3d I wouldn't jump the gun and upgrade from the EVO 4g, but if you want a phone with 3d capabilities then I'll say go for it. You won't be disappointed with this phone.

Pros:
Good battery life
Beautiful screen display
3d looks awsome
Dual core processors

Cons:
No kick stand
Speakerphone
Charging port is on the side
